A college principal in Uttar Pradesh triggered widespread outrage after making controversial remarks during a meeting with students. The incident in Sambhal district has reignited debate over student union elections and campus administration.

A video of a college principal making objectionable remarks about “misdeeds” in front of students has sparked widespread outrage across Uttar Pradesh, after the clip went viral on social media and drew strong reactions.

The incident took place in Sambhal district’s SM Degree College, Chandausi, where students had gathered to submit a memorandum demanding student union elections and raise issues related to campus administration, including parking fees. During the interaction, principal Danveer Singh was recorded making comments that many students and viewers described as insensitive and inappropriate.

In the video, as students presented their demands, the principal is heard speaking about his personality, saying he is open and straightforward. He then made a controversial statement suggesting that people usually commit misdeeds secretly, while claiming he speaks openly and frankly, a remark that triggered sharp criticism.

The clip also shows the principal making remarks about Chandausi, calling it a town with a “small mindset,” and commenting on restrictions related to students’ socialising. He said that while he did not stop students of his own college from roaming around, he objected to interactions with outsiders, stressing that students should maintain limits and dignity.

The controversy gained further attention as Chandausi is the home constituency of Uttar Pradesh’s Minister of State for Secondary Education, Gulabo Devi, who is also the local MLA. Following the backlash, the principal issued an oral clarification, stating that his remarks were taken out of context and that by “misdeeds” he meant bad actions in a general sense.

However, despite the clarification, student anger remains high, with demands growing for action against the principal and an official inquiry into the incident.
